comparemela.com

Top Locations Tagged with Car Wash In 63134

Car Wash In 63134 in United States - 63134/Cleaning-service near St Louis

1). Wright Cleaning Service, LLC

2). S & P Car Wash & Customizing

3). Top 2 Bottom Carwash

4). Aqua Wash LLC

vimarsana © 2020. All Rights Reserved.